• Automatic Detection Where a clear benefit resulting from the addition of detection and warning
systems is demonstrated, a 15% increase in allowable travel distance and a 15% reduction in door
width, corridor width and stair width can be applied.
• Ceiling Heights Rooms with high ceilings have a greater capacity to hold smoke and delay the
time taken to fill with smoke to a level that affects escape.
Room Height Maximum permissible increase in travel distance and reduction in
(m) door width, corridor width and stair width All risk profiles except
Risk profiles A4, B4 and C4, which are “Not Allowable”
>4, ≤5 10 %
>5, ≤6 15 %
These values can be aggregated up to a maximum of 25% reduction in stair width
